The Framewright transcoding farm exposes a `/jobs` endpoint for checking stuck encodes — handy when a customer says their upload "vanished." Query by job ID and you'll get stage, progress, and any error blob. All requests need the internal support credential in the `X-Frame-Key` header, shown below.

gateway credential: kto3_qfe

Hi — closing the loop on last night's cut-over of the Spindleway bike-share rebalancing tool. We switched dispatching from the legacy spreadsheet export to the live optimizer at 02:10, after confirming dock occupancy feeds were stable for two hours. Drivers in the Harrowvale pilot zone received routes from the new engine without manual intervention, and fill-rate variance dropped noticeably by morning peak. Rollback scripts remain staged for one week. For the record, the optimizer went live with these configuration values.

config for kafof-bawef:
holath:
  log_level: debug
  metrics_host: metrics.holath.qorvelsys.internal
  pin: 2191
  pool_size: 32

Subject: DR drill Thursday — heads up on the baseline file

Hi support crew, quick one. During Thursday's disaster-recovery drill we'll restore Tindervale from cold storage, and the static-analysis baseline file (the one that suppresses the 900-odd legacy warnings) will get wiped. Don't panic when the lint dashboard goes red — that's expected. To regenerate the baseline you'll need elevated access on the Copperjay box, which asks for the recovery passphrase shown below.

unlock words, yawig-kagef: gordor-holvan-ulaael-pramir-ulaiel-tamdor